当前位置: 首页 > news >正文

vue3报错:this.$refs.** undefined

背景:异步加载数据回填到this.$refs.** 中,浏览器报错找不到 this.$refs.** 。

进过阅读资料,提到是组件未初始化,意思是页面没加载出来前, this.$refs是无法使用的。

解决:

先加载页面

 <el-dialog :title="title" :visible.sync="open" width="75%" class="cust-task-index"  append-to-body><link-test-history-table  ref="historyTable" /></el-dialog>

比如我的对话框是用变量open控制,那么在调用this.$refs.** 前,设置代码

this.open = true ,让对话框加载。

然后再对this.$refs.historyTable 赋值,解决改问题。

http://www.lryc.cn/news/601521.html

相关文章:

  • nacos连接失败,启动失败常见问题
  • Vue 框架 学习笔记
  • 【笔记】Einstein关系式 D = ukBT 的推导与应用研究
  • GAN/cGAN中到底要不要注入噪声
  • 计算机网络:(十二)传输层(上)运输层协议概述
  • FPGA IP升级
  • Linux文件理解,基础IO理解
  • SCUDATA esProc SPL Enterprise Edition(大数据计算引擎) v20250605 中文免费版
  • Keepalive高可用集群的实验项目
  • 【Java系统接口幂等性解决实操】
  • DeepSeek实战--无头浏览器抓取技术
  • Java常用日志框架介绍
  • 五度标调法调域统计分析工具
  • 设计模式(五)创建型:原型模式详解
  • [spring6: Mvc-异步请求]-源码分析
  • 设计模式(三)创建型:抽象工厂模式详解
  • 微服务架构面试题
  • Flutter开发实战之测试驱动开发
  • linux根据pid获取服务目录
  • Gradio.NET 中文快速入门与用法说明
  • IIS发布.NET9 API 常见报错汇总
  • 从 .NET Framework 到 .NET 8:跨平台融合史诗与生态演进全景
  • 9-大语言模型—Transformer 核心:多头注意力的 10 步拆解与可视化理解
  • 电商项目_核心业务_数据归档
  • Java枚举类enum;记录类Record;密封类Sealed、permits
  • Java面试宝典:MySQL执行原理一
  • 300.最长递增子序列,674. 最长连续递增序列,
  • Ubuntu服务器安装与运维手册——操作纯享版
  • 负载均衡Haproxy
  • [AI8051U入门第十一步]W5500-服务端